Description: Opportunity:
Saint Francis Hospital is looking to add a board-certified Physician Assistant for the inpatient hematology/oncology role.
- Work alongside a highly motivated and collaborative team providing care 7 days on and 7 days off
- Competitive compensation and benefits including $15,000 stipend, medical, dental, vision and retirement options
- CME support of $2,000 annually plus full coverage for licensure, DEA, and OBNDD fees
- EPIC EMR with advanced AI technology capabilities through Dax Copilot.
- As a not-for-profit system, Saint Francis qualifies for Public Service Loan Forgiveness (PSLF)
Requirements:
- Experienced PA or NP preferred
- Strong clinical skills and patient-centered approach
- Board Certification and ability to obtain a practice license in Oklahoma prior to start date
- APRN must have acute care certification
